SHIEL, Alan (Dundrum, Dublin) - November 9 2014, (peacefully) at home, surrounded by his loving family, after an illness borne with courage, dignity and humour. Will be hugely missed by his adoring wife, Helen; Sarah, Mikey and Eoin; Alison and Orna; his mother, Hazel; sisters, Cecily and Sylvia; and by the whole family circle and his many friends. Reposing at his home, the house will be open from 2pm - 6pm today (Tuesday). A Funeral Service will be held in Dundrum Methodist Church tomorrow (Wednesday) at 11.30am with cremation to follow in Mount Jerome Crematorium, Harold's Cross. Family flowers only please; donations, if desired, can be made to the Irish Cancer Society c/o Nichols Funeral Directors, Lombard Street East, Dublin 2."I am with you always,
until the end of time"
